Quote:
Sometimes WM won't recognize mp3s created at higher bps or with certain codecs (I've had issues with files when they were MP3 or mp3PRO vs mp3. Some files created with particular software have given me issues as well.) Also, since notifications are generally quite short, using a full wav file installed in \Windows seems to make for quicker reactions and hence I don't lose that first bit of sound (usually under 1sec) before it starts to be audible. |
